Map Library (HC201)

The Map Library, although a Departmental Library, is open to all full-time staff and students of HKU after they have completed registration procedures and been issued with a Map Library card. Access and use by other persons is by prior arrangement with the Department. It has a collection of over 61,700 map items (with particular emphasis on Hong Kong, and East & Southeast Asia); a rapidly growing collection of over 15,900 air photos (especially on Hong Kong); a sizeable number of atlases, wall maps, marine charts, satellite images, cartobibliographies, audio and video tapes, and CD-ROMs. It is one of the most comprehensive of its kind in Hong Kong and nearby region. The Library also houses more than 1,600 geography dissertations and postgraduate theses, completed from 1968 onwards. These are available for reference use only within the Map Library.

A number of PCs with access to the Campus network are also provided for use by undergraduate and postgraduate students for the purpose of searching reference books, teaching materials and other academic information through the Internet. A Xerox reduction/enlargement engineering copier is available for reproducing A4 to A0 sized maps for academic use (subject to copyright constraints). A Ricoh colour photo copier is also available for color-copying of materials. A schedule of charges for the use of copying facilities is posted on the Department webpage.
